WebYes, it is safe to refreeze cooked tilapia thawed in a refrigerator. According to USDA, refreezing any fish that thaws in a refrigerator is perfectly safe. But avoid keeping the tilapia at room temperature for more than two hours. If this limit exceeds, it can longer refreeze, and you have to discard the fish. WebThe answer is yes, you can reheat fish. WebTo maximize the shelf life of cooked tilapia for safety and quality, refrigerate the tilapia in shallow airtight containers or wrap tightly with heavy-duty aluminum foil or plastic wrap. Properly stored, cooked tilapia will last for 3 to 4 days in the refrigerator.
